Producer

Bestheim Chateaux

Bestheim Chateaux showcases a mastery of terroir, producing distinctive wines that reflect their rich heritage. Renowned for their exquisite Crémant and Alsace varietals, the winery primarily utilizes Pinot Noir, Riesling, and Gewürztraminer. Expect vibrant floral notes, ripe stone fruits, and elegant minerality. With a commitment to sustainable practices, Bestheim Chateaux weaves history and innovation, inviting connoisseurs to savor the elegance of their carefully crafted vintages, each a testament to the artistry of winemaking.

Grape

Gewürztraminer

Gewürztraminer is one of the few grape varieties where the name hints at its distinctive fragrance—literally meaning "spicy traminer." Known for its aromatic intensity, this grape unfolds a tapestry of exotic lychee, rose petal, and ginger notes, often enveloped in a luscious, sometimes off-dry texture. Thriving in cooler regions like Alsace, Germany, and parts of the New World, Gewürztraminer wines can range from delicate to bold, making them a captivating choice for adventurous palates.
